pip安装python库的方法总结


Posted in Python onAugust 02, 2019

使用pip安装python库的几种方式

1、使用pip在线安装

1.1 安装单个package

格式如下:

pip install SomePackage

示例如下:

比如:pip install scipy

或者指定版本安装:pip install scipy==1.3.0

1.2 安装多个package

示例如下:

pip install -r req.txt

req.txt 可以通过以下命令获取:

pip freeze > req.txt

1.3 在线安装的其它问题

1.3.1 代理问题

如果需要通过代理安装,可以使用如下格式:

pip --proxy=ip:port install SomePackage

1.3.2 pip源问题

如果pip源太慢,可以更换pip源,有以下两种方式:

方式一:通过修改参数临时修改pip源

比如使用阿里云的pip源:

pip install Sphinx -i http://mirrors.aliyun.com/pypi/simple/ --trusted-host mirrors.aliyun.com

方式二:通过修改配置文件永久修改pip源

文件: ~/.pip/pip.conf

比如使用阿里云的pip源:

[admin@localhost .pip]$ cat ~/.pip/pip.conf

[global]

index-url = http://mirrors.aliyun.com/pypi/simple/

extra-index-url=http://mirrors.aliyun.com/pypi/simple/

[install]

trusted-host = mirrors.aliyun.com

[admin@localhost .pip]$

也可以使用自建pip源,或者其它公开pip源,比如:

阿里云 http://mirrors.aliyun.com/pypi/simple/

豆瓣(douban) http://pypi.douban.com/simple/

清华大学 https://pypi.tuna.tsinghua.edu.cn/simple/

中国科学技术大学 http://pypi.mirrors.ustc.edu.cn/simple/

2、从源码安装

示例如下:

git clone https://github.com/sphinx-doc/sphinx

cd sphinx

pip install .

3、从 whl 文件安装

格式如下:

pip install SomePackage.whl

以上就是关于本次知识点的全部内容,感谢大家对三水点靠木的支持。

Python 相关文章推荐
Python+MongoDB自增键值的简单实现
Nov 04 Python
Python在for循环中更改list值的方法【推荐】
Aug 17 Python
python 保存float类型的小数的位数方法
Oct 17 Python
pandas dataframe添加表格框线输出的方法
Feb 08 Python
Python基础学习之函数方法实例详解
Jun 18 Python
大家都说好用的Python命令行库click的使用
Nov 07 Python
Python continue语句实例用法
Feb 06 Python
Python线程协作threading.Condition实现过程解析
Mar 12 Python
Java爬虫技术框架之Heritrix框架详解
Jul 22 Python
如何利用python生成MD5并去重
Dec 07 Python
五分钟学会怎么用python做一个简单的贪吃蛇
Jan 12 Python
Python开发.exe小工具的详细步骤
Jan 27 Python
python twilio模块实现发送手机短信功能
Aug 02 #Python
python代码 FTP备份交换机配置脚本实例解析
Aug 01 #Python
Windows系统Python直接调用C++ DLL的方法
Aug 01 #Python
Python CVXOPT模块安装及使用解析
Aug 01 #Python
Python Selenium 之数据驱动测试的实现
Aug 01 #Python
Python 一键获取百度网盘提取码的方法
Aug 01 #Python
Django中的静态文件管理过程解析
Aug 01 #Python
You might like
php中json_decode()和json_encode()的使用方法
2012/06/04 PHP
phpinfo()中Loaded Configuration File(none)的解决方法
2017/01/16 PHP
PHP curl 或 file_get_contents 获取需要授权页面的方法
2017/05/05 PHP
Laravel 实现密码重置功能
2018/02/23 PHP
Extjs中常用表单介绍与应用
2010/06/07 Javascript
让你的CSS像Jquery一样做筛选的实现方法
2011/07/10 Javascript
jQuery fadeTo方法调整图片的透明度使用介绍
2013/05/06 Javascript
Jquery对数组的操作技巧整理
2014/03/25 Javascript
jQuery菜单插件用法实例
2015/07/25 Javascript
关注jquery技巧提高jquery技能(前端开发必学)
2015/11/02 Javascript
javascript实现全角转半角的方法
2016/01/23 Javascript
javascript如何实现360度全景照片问题汇总
2016/04/04 Javascript
jquery.form.js框架实现文件上传功能案例解析(springmvc)
2016/05/26 Javascript
最全的Javascript编码规范(推荐)
2016/06/22 Javascript
vuejs响应用户事件(如点击事件)
2017/03/14 Javascript
js模块加载方式浅析
2017/08/12 Javascript
详解JavaScript基础知识(JSON、Function对象、原型、引用类型)
2018/01/16 Javascript
在小程序中使用canvas的方法示例
2018/09/17 Javascript
angularjs实现table表格td单元格单击变输入框/可编辑状态示例
2019/02/21 Javascript
vue使用localStorage保存登录信息 适用于移动端、PC端
2019/05/27 Javascript
微信小程序错误this.setData报错及解决过程
2019/09/18 Javascript
vue实现倒计时获取验证码效果
2020/04/17 Javascript
javascript实现弹出层效果
2019/12/10 Javascript
python实现感知器
2017/12/19 Python
Python实现微信小程序支付功能
2019/07/25 Python
Python中使用filter过滤列表的一个小技巧分享
2020/05/02 Python
Python的scikit-image模块实例讲解
2020/12/30 Python
浅析python实现动态规划背包问题
2020/12/31 Python
python利用文件时间批量重命名照片和视频
2021/02/09 Python
一款利用纯css3实现的win8加载动画的实例分析
2014/12/11 HTML / CSS
捐款倡议书范文
2014/02/02 职场文书
学生会辞职信
2015/03/02 职场文书
2016新教师岗前培训心得体会
2016/01/08 职场文书
nginx网站服务如何配置防盗链(推荐)
2021/03/31 Servers
Python 机器学习工具包SKlearn的安装与使用
2021/05/14 Python
Java常用工具类汇总 附示例代码
2021/06/26 Java/Android